Program description
Our Computer Science Masters courses are flexible so that you can focus on areas that interest you.
The MSc offers the chance to study a number of topics in the computer science area, including: principles of system design; software engineering; enterprise computing; computing architecture; and applications of artificial intelligence; students also have the opportunity to undertake an individual project based on subjects that interest them as well as research at the university or their industrial experience if they do a placement.
The MRes course is designed to give students the opportunity to develop research skills in a computing area that meets their interests and career development needs; it allows students to combine material from any of the taught Master's courses with an extended research project over a one year period.
Admission requirements
Does this course require proof of English proficiency?
The TOEFL® test is accepted by 10,000+ universities and higher education institutes in over 150 countries. Book your test today!
Learn moreAbout this institute

Nottingham Trent University is a teaching intensive university. Our students are our first priority. This focus has led us to being named University of the Year 2017 by Times Higher Education and The Times / Sunday Times Good University Guide Modern University of the...